When the idol is immersed

The idol is kept for one and a half, three, five, seven days or until Anant Chaturdashi — it is a family custom rather than a rule, and community mandapams usually keep it longest.

Use the designated immersion point

Many gram panchayats and municipalities set aside a pond or a marked stretch of tank for immersion. Ask at the panchayat office — it changes year to year, and a drinking-water tank or a farm pond is not an alternative.

Unpainted clay dissolves, plaster of Paris does not

A clay idol breaks down in water within hours. Plaster of Paris does not, and the paints carry heavy metals, so idols accumulate in tanks and rivers after immersion. Pollution control boards in most states now ask for clay for exactly this reason.

Someone should be watching the water, not the idol

Immersion points get crowded and the bank is slippery after the monsoon. Children go into the water at these gatherings every year. Keep one person watching the water rather than the procession.

Take the accessories home

Thermocol, plastic sheeting, cloth and metal ornaments do not belong in the tank even when the idol itself is clay. Most organised immersion points now have a collection bin at the bank for them.

Tyod at a glance

Tyod is a village of 3,450 people in 598 households (Census 2011) in Roopangarh tehsil, Ajmer district, Rajasthan, the 5th-largest of 62 villages in Roopangarh tehsil. Literacy is 42%, 5 points below the tehsil average of 47% and the sex ratio is 869 women per 1,000 men. The pincode is 305814, served by Roopnagar post office; the LGD village code is 91435. The village votes in Pushkar assembly constituency, represented by MLA Suresh Singh. The population is estimated at 4,068 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
